Richard Wilson McGee Jr., born March 23, 1920, passed away peacefully, in his sleep, November 17, 2015. He was preceded in 2012 by his wife of 71 years, Virginia McGee. He is survived by his 5 children, 9 grandchildren, 7 great-grandchildren and a very devoted family friend who took great care of him in his final years.

Dick was a Veteran, having served with the Army during WWII, one of the "greatest generation". He loved his country and was very proud of his service, as was his family.

He touched many lives and was well loved by both family and friends. He will be whole-heartedly missed.

A Celebration of Richard's life will be held at the Bullock Colonial Chapel on Monday, November 23rd at 10:00 a.m. with interment following at Fort Logan National Cemetery with military honors.
